body 
{
	margin: 0;
	padding: 0;
	background: #fff; 
	font-family: Arial, sans-serif;
	font-size:13px;
}

.header
{
margin:20px;
}

.home_header
{
text-align: center; /* for IE */
margin:50px auto 0 auto;
}

.footer
{
text-align: center; /* for IE */
margin:20px auto 0 auto;
color:#0362AF;
}

.footer a, .footer a:visited
{
color:#0362AF;
}

.container
{
margin:20px;
}

.logo
{
float:left;
width:220px;
}

.SearchBox
{
}

.inputbox
{
}

.searchbutton
{
}

.mainline
{
width:650px;
float:left;
margin-right:20px;
}

.leftnav
{
width:220px;
float:left;
}

.title
{
font-size:18px;
color:#3399DD;
}

.inline_title
{
font-size:13px;
color:#3399DD;
}

.description, .description a
{
color:#0362AF;
text-decoration:none;
}

.click_url, .click_url a
{
color:#33BB22;
text-decoration:none;
}

h1, h1 a, h1 a:visited
{
font-size:18px;
color:#0362AF;
font-weight:bold;
text-decoration:none;
margin-top:0;
}

h1 a:hover
{
text-decoration:underline;
}

.tinythumb
{
border:solid 1px #ccc;
margin:2px;
}

.videothumb
{
float:left;
margin-right:5px;
height:160px;
}

.videothumb img
{
border:solid 1px #ccc;
}

.relatedterms a, .scopes a
{
font-size:13px;
}

.pagenav
{
margin:20px 0 20px 0;
}

.pagenav a
{
border:solid 1px #3399DD;
width:20px;
padding:2px 5px 2px 5px;
text-align:center;
color:#3399DD;
text-decoration:none;
}

.scopebar
{
border:solid 1px #3399DD;
width:200px;
text-decoration:none;
}

.scopebar a
{
width:200px;
padding:2px 5px 2px 5px;
color:#3399DD;
text-decoration:none;
}

.pagenav a:visited, .scopebar a:visited
{
color:#3399DD;
}

.pagenav a:hover, .scopebar a:hover
{
background:#3399DD;
color:white;
}

.pagenav .selected, .scopebar .selected
{
border:solid 1px #3399DD;
width:20px;
padding:2px 5px 2px 5px;
text-align:center;
background:#3399DD;
color:white;
text-decoration:none;
}

td
{
color:#0362AF;
font-family: Arial, sans-serif;
font-size:13px;
}

.sponsored
{
margin-left:-7px;
}
